When you start from a Vendor crap driver, part of the process of getting it into Mainline is getting it up to Mainline quality. If this was C code, i would be trying to replace as many of the magic numbers with #define. And then add comments about the best guess what things are doing, based on the datasheet. The data sheet however does not explain all the bits, nor give every register a name. But you should use as much information as possible from the datasheet to make the code as readable as possible.
